  • Patent number: 11750772
    Abstract: Enterprise communication display systems enable life-like images for videoconferencing and entertainment productions. Life-like images appear in a 3D environment where imaged people are visible through specially configured see-through displays. Imaged people can be viewed amongst a reflected foreground. Methods for enterprise-wide deployments for corporate, healthcare, education, theater which includes cinema and government communications, including hotel properties and a property management system are shown. Direct projection see-through screen configurations are created that eliminate unwanted secondary images in the room, conceal exposed projector lenses, reduce lens flare, makes practical multi-use room installations, images conferees among a room environment, enables touch screen interactivity, and utilizes extreme and other types of short throw projectors to reduce cost and bulk of common throw projectors.

  • Publication number: 20220247971
    Abstract: A telepresence communication system for group meeting rooms and personal home and office systems provides improved human factor experience through substantially life size images with eye level camera placement. The system provides switched presence interfaces so that conferees can select when to transmit their images during a conference and optionally provides individual microphones for each of conferee. Switched presence between presets of conferees are viewed on multipoint windows overlaying life-size images upon eye contact camera regions and eliminate seeing camera image movement during pan, tilt and zoom operations. An ambient light rejecting filter system enables an eye level camera to be hidden behind a projection screen and provides bright, high contrast images under normal meeting room and office environments.

  • Publication number: 20200143486
    Abstract: Disclosed herein is a social media platform that enables a user with one account to access multiple social environments partitioned for various aspects of their lives. The partitioned platform creates environments for a user's personal life and professional life and also connected and partitioned to the user's enterprise life, which is privately controlled by an organization such as a business. Methods for shared computing devices are disclosed for use with the social media platform in physical locations such as corporate meeting rooms and hotel rooms. Further a method in presented for suggesting, navigating, selecting and engaging one of numerous disconnected collaboration applications. Further several methods for increasing social media adoption are disclosed as well as integration of the platform with a property management system.
